Erro Query: Fild Not found
05/04/2021
0
como resolver o erro QFunc: Filed ''usuario'' not found.
DM.QFunc.SQL.Clear;
DM.QFunc.SQL.Add(''Select * from funcionarios where usuario = :usuario and senha = :senha'');
DM.QFunc.FieldByName(''usuario'').value := Edtlogin.Text;
DM.QFunc.FieldByName(''senha'').value := Edtsenha.Text;
DM.QFunc.Open;
DM.QFunc.SQL.Clear;
DM.QFunc.SQL.Add(''Select * from funcionarios where usuario = :usuario and senha = :senha'');
DM.QFunc.FieldByName(''usuario'').value := Edtlogin.Text;
DM.QFunc.FieldByName(''senha'').value := Edtsenha.Text;
DM.QFunc.Open;
Wagner
Curtir tópico
+ 0
Responder
Posts
05/04/2021
Emerson Nascimento
para preencher os parâmetros você não deve usar FieldByName; deve usar ParamByName.
DM.QFunc.SQL.Clear; DM.QFunc.SQL.Add('Select * from funcionarios where usuario = :usuario and senha = :senha'); DM.QFunc.ParamByName('usuario').AsString := Edtlogin.Text; DM.QFunc.ParamByName('senha').AsString := Edtsenha.Text; DM.QFunc.Open;
Responder
Clique aqui para fazer login e interagir na Comunidade :)